I purchased 2x XFX HD5850 to run in crossfire. At first I had issues getting the system to post because the ram would not seat correctly even though it appeared to be completely seated. -- Fluke? Ram Issue? Motherboard issue?

After swapping the ram around the only way I got the system to post was with ram in slots 1 & 4.

In windows after uninstalling my Nvidia driver I restarted the system, and upon re-entering windows the system randomly restarted. After I got the ATI drivers going I attempt to run Final Fantasy 14, which ends at the character screen restarting the computer. I thought it was a fluke at first, but then I attempted ARMA II, and Left for Dead, all resulting with the sytem restarting. The games all played very very well while I was in.

So, thinking the issue I have could be Power Supply related, I took out one of the graphics cards. I started up Left for Dead and the same thing happened again.

So then I removed the the RAM and attempted to place them in Slots 1 & 3, as prior to the upgrade that is where the ram was and was stable. After the system failed to post I swapped the ram back to 1 & 4 which worked prior, and the system failed to post again, this time, it's as though there is no power at all. The fans twich a little bit... but that is it. No Smoke, No Smell, Just nothing but a few twitching fans.
